The Puzzle Project is an interactive software system that solves jigsaw puzzles. The voice interface includes speech synthesis and word recognition. The attributes of the puzzle pieces are determined using image processing techniques and wavelet decomposition. Two algorithms are used to solve the puzzles: an expert system and fuzzy logic. This paper describes the steps required to find the solution to the puzzle from image processing to decision-making algorithms. It also explains the techniques involved in designing the voice interface
